Output 42b8630d11d2a511c5366da6815b65b9b54c90c06979f20b4d6913c3972a2eac:36

value
1295197
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b148bea25a118f90e485615ccbb4a7e9b4a024b OP_EQUAL
address
39zc2bhUjpAqn4TAGCcfp6mAj9FyM5Gi9T
transaction
42b8630d11d2a511c5366da6815b65b9b54c90c06979f20b4d6913c3972a2eac
confirmations
190581
spent
true